A quick little look into a backwater planet like none I've ever read of before. It was fun to see how neatly she managed to package all the themes into those quick 200 pages. Feminism and gender roles, what it means to be human, even the dangers of blind devotion.
I always enjoy anything by this author, and I'm pleased to see that Starmother was no exception. Van Scyoc is wonderful at what she does, and leaves just the right amount of story untold to satisfy me.
